Prime Minister David Cameron was urged to intervene today after a British Muslim family was prevented from flying to the United States for a visit to Disneyland.

According to the AFP News Agency, the family of 11 was stopped from boarding their flight to Los Angeles at London’s Gatwick airport on Tuesday last week by immigration officials.

Mohammad Tariq Mahmood, who was travelling with his brother and nine of their children, said the officials gave no reason for blocking their travel plans.

Mahmood’s local lawmaker in London, Stella Creasy of the main opposition Labour party, has asked Cameron to look into what happened.
